Radish alpha
r
Radicle web interface
Radicle
Git (anonymous pull)
Log in to clone via SSH
Use capitalize from lodash
Rūdolfs Ošiņš committed 3 years ago
commit 894435de79bfe5c3e24abfdf1e5ecf40592e25a8
parent 46666fd6da8161b4be63e4d053fcd2a2f3ea454e
5 files changed +7 -11
modified src/components/TabBar.svelte
@@ -9,8 +9,8 @@
<script lang="ts" strictEvents>
  type T = $$Generic;

+
  import capitalize from "lodash/capitalize";
  import { createEventDispatcher } from "svelte";
-
  import { capitalize } from "@app/lib/utils";

  export let options: Tab<T>[];
  export let active: T;
modified src/lib/utils.ts
@@ -114,11 +114,6 @@ export function formatCommit(oid: string): string {
  return oid.substring(0, 7);
}

-
export function capitalize(s: string): string {
-
  if (s === "") return s;
-
  return s[0].toUpperCase() + s.substring(1);
-
}
-

// Takes a path, eg. "../images/image.png", and a base from where to start resolving, e.g. "static/images/index.html".
// Returns the resolved path.
export function canonicalize(
modified src/views/projects/Issues.svelte
@@ -11,7 +11,7 @@

  import * as router from "@app/lib/router";
  import * as utils from "@app/lib/utils";
-
  import { capitalize } from "@app/lib/utils";
+
  import capitalize from "lodash/capitalize";
  import { groupIssues } from "@app/lib/issue";
  import { sessionStore } from "@app/lib/session";

modified src/views/projects/Patch.svelte
@@ -33,13 +33,14 @@
  import Comment from "@app/components/Comment.svelte";
  import CommitTeaser from "./Commit/CommitTeaser.svelte";
  import Dropdown from "@app/components/Dropdown.svelte";
-
  import HeaderToggleLabel from "./HeaderToggleLabel.svelte";
  import Floating from "@app/components/Floating.svelte";
+
  import HeaderToggleLabel from "./HeaderToggleLabel.svelte";
  import TabBar from "@app/components/TabBar.svelte";
  import Thread from "@app/components/Thread.svelte";
+
  import capitalize from "lodash/capitalize";
  import { Patch } from "@app/lib/patch";
-
  import { capitalize, formatCommit, isLocal } from "@app/lib/utils";
  import { createAddRemoveArrays } from "@app/lib/issue";
+
  import { formatCommit, isLocal } from "@app/lib/utils";
  import { formatObjectId, validateTag } from "@app/lib/cobs";
  import { sessionStore } from "@app/lib/session";

modified src/views/projects/Patches.svelte
@@ -9,9 +9,9 @@
  import type { Project } from "@app/lib/project";

  import * as router from "@app/lib/router";
-
  import * as utils from "@app/lib/utils";
  import PatchTeaser from "./Patch/PatchTeaser.svelte";
  import Placeholder from "@app/components/Placeholder.svelte";
+
  import capitalize from "lodash/capitalize";

  export let patches: Patch[];
  export let status: PatchStatus;
@@ -59,7 +59,7 @@
    </div>
  {:else}
    <Placeholder emoji="🍂">
-
      <div slot="title">{utils.capitalize(status)} patches</div>
+
      <div slot="title">{capitalize(status)} patches</div>
      <div slot="body">No issues matched the current filter</div>
    </Placeholder>
  {/if}